Shaping the Future of Clinical Safety with Data Analytics

As medical industry adopts increasingly complex technologies, ensuring clinical safety becomes paramount. Leveraging the power of data analytics offers a groundbreaking opportunity to enhance patient health. By examining vast datasets from electronic health records, clinical trials, and wearable devices, we can identify potential safety threats earlier and more accurately. This proactive approach allows for prompt interventions, minimizing adverse events and enhancing patient outcomes.

  • Data-driven insights can inform the development of safer drugs and medical devices.
  • Real-time monitoring systems can alert clinicians to potential complications, enabling swift action.
  • Predictive analytics can help identify high-risk patients, allowing for personalized safety strategies.

Digital Twins and Personalized Medicine: Advancing Clinical Safety

With the development of digital twins and personalized medicine, clinical safety is undergoing a significant transformation. Digital twins, virtual representations of patients or medical devices, allow for accurate simulations and predictions, enabling healthcare providers to customize treatments based on individual patient traits. This advancement in medicine leads to enhanced treatment outcomes, minimized adverse events, and ultimately, a safer clinical environment.
